The HR Shared Services Tier 2 Rep Specialist provides expert direction and assistance in resolving complex issues related to benefits and PTO administration. They act as a Subject Matter Expert for Workday and develop efficient processes to support customers while ensuring compliance with policies and regulations.
Candidates should possess a comprehensive knowledge of Human Resources and benefits plan design, with a preference for a bachelor's degree and relevant certifications. A minimum of four to five years of progressive experience in an HR specialist or support role is required.

Trinity Health is one of the largest not-for-profit, faith-based health care systems in the nation. Together, we’re 121,000 colleagues and nearly 36,500 physicians and clinicians caring for diverse communities across 27 states. Nationally recognized for care and experience, our system includes 101 hospitals, 126 continuing care locations, the second largest PACE program in the country, 136 urgent care locations, and many other health and well-being services. Based in Livonia, Michigan, in fiscal year 2023, we invested $1.5 billion in our communities through charity care and other community benefit programs.
